Intuit QuickBooks 2009 through 2012 might allow remote attackers to obtain pathname information via the qbwc://docontrol/GetCompanyFile functionality.

CVE-2012-2422 is considered to have a medium severity due to the potential information disclosure it presents.
To fix CVE-2012-2422, users should upgrade to a patched version of Intuit QuickBooks beyond 2012.
The potential impact of CVE-2012-2422 includes unauthorized access to pathname information by remote attackers.
CVE-2012-2422 affects Intuit QuickBooks versions 2009 through 2012.
